Cornwall, Centre Ward—Quartier, Ontario (1881 census)
Cornwall, Centre Ward—Quartier was a census subdivision in Ontario, recorded in the 1881 Census of Canada with a population of 1,693. The administrative centroid was at approximately 45.021°N, 74.725°W.
Population
In 1881, Cornwall, Centre Ward—Quartier had a population of 1,693: 807 male and 886 female residents. Population density was 2161.8 people per square mile.
Population trajectory across census years
| Year | Population |
|---|---|
| 1871 | 1,086 |
| 1881 | 1,693 |
| 1891 | 2,116 |
